freedreno/drm-shim: Add support for faking other adreno chips.

I wanted to look at the effect of a core NIR change on a2xx codegen, but I
don't have any of those boards.  This could also prove useful for quickly
sanity-checking the compiler by running shader-db on it -- a2xx fails in a
few ways on glmark2, and a3xx-a5xx fails on glmark2 in a debug_assert
(which we don't have enabled in our dEQP runs).

+#define CHIPID(maj, min, rev, pat) \
+	((maj << 24) | (min << 16) | (rev << 8) | (pat))
+
+static const struct msm_device_info device_infos[] = {
+	{ /* First entry is default */
+		.gpu_id = 630,
+		.chip_id = CHIPID(6, 3, 0, 0xff),
+		.gmem_size = 1024 * 1024,
+	},
+	{
+		.gpu_id = 200,
+		.chip_id = CHIPID(2, 0, 0, 0),
+		.gmem_size = 256 * 1024,
+	},
+	{
+		.gpu_id = 201,
+		.chip_id = CHIPID(2, 0, 0, 1),
+		.gmem_size = 128 * 1024,
+	},
+	{
+		.gpu_id = 220,
+		.chip_id = CHIPID(2, 2, 0, 0xff),
+		.gmem_size = 512 * 1024,
+	},
+	{
+		.gpu_id = 305,
+		.chip_id = CHIPID(3, 0, 5, 0xff),
+		.gmem_size = 256 * 1024,
+	},
+	{
+		.gpu_id = 307,
+		.chip_id = CHIPID(3, 0, 6, 0),
+		.gmem_size = 128 * 1024,
+	},
+	{
+		.gpu_id = 320,
+		.chip_id = CHIPID(3, 2, 0xff, 0xff),
+		.gmem_size = 512 * 1024,
+	},
+	{
+		.gpu_id = 330,
+		.chip_id = CHIPID(3, 3, 0, 0xff),
+		.gmem_size = 1024 * 1024,
+	},
+	{
+		.gpu_id = 420,
+		.chip_id = CHIPID(4, 2, 0, 0xff),
+		.gmem_size = 1536 * 1024,
+	},
+	{
+		.gpu_id = 430,
+		.chip_id = CHIPID(4, 3, 0, 0xff),
+		.gmem_size = 1536 * 1024,
+	},
+	{
+		.gpu_id = 510,
+		.chip_id = CHIPID(5, 1, 0, 0xff),
+		.gmem_size = 256 * 1024,
+	},
+	{
+		.gpu_id = 530,
+		.chip_id = CHIPID(5, 3, 0, 2),
+		.gmem_size = 1024 * 1024,
+	},
+	{
+		.gpu_id = 540,
+		.chip_id = CHIPID(5, 4, 0, 2),
+		.gmem_size = 1024 * 1024,
+	},
+	{
+		.gpu_id = 618,
+		.chip_id = CHIPID(6, 1, 8, 0xff),
+		.gmem_size = 512 * 1024,
+	},
+	{
+		.gpu_id = 630,
+		.chip_id = CHIPID(6, 3, 0, 0xff),
+		.gmem_size = 1024 * 1024,
+	},
+};
